Transaction e139a98be87ee1134b6f810d357a553013980f44dbe19981de20dd3ef0972036
1 Input
1 Output
-
e139a98be87ee1134b6f810d357a553013980f44dbe19981de20dd3ef0972036:0
- value
- 518332
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 537e415ebbe7a344b4238aa49c360cac59708841 OP_EQUAL
- address
- 39JVFqkRMjhnZSGshHB8vk39xHWoNpBKuk